The Timeless Tradition of Block Printing in Rajasthan

Rajasthan has long been known as the land of colors, crafts, and traditions. Among its many art forms, hand block printing stands out as one of the oldest and most celebrated textile traditions. For centuries, artisans in regions like Sanganer and Bagru have been carving wooden blocks, dipping them in natural dyes, and pressing them onto cotton fabrics – creating patterns that tell stories of culture, heritage, and craftsmanship.

The Origins of Block Printing
Block printing in India dates back more than 500 years, with Rajasthan becoming the epicenter due to its abundance of natural resources like cotton, indigo, turmeric, and pomegranate peels used in dyeing. The Chippa community, known for their mastery in this craft, passed the art form down through generations.

Bagru & Sanganeri Prints – The Pride of Rajasthan

  • Bagru Prints: Famous for earthy tones, bold motifs, and the use of natural dyes. Bagru designs often feature floral patterns, geometric shapes, and traditional borders.

  • Sanganeri Prints: Known for delicate floral motifs, fine outlines, and the use of bright colors on white or light backgrounds. These prints became popular in royal courts and later found global recognition.

The Process – From Wood to Fabric
Each block is hand-carved from seasoned wood, often taking days to prepare. The fabric is then pre-washed, dyed, and carefully stamped with precision. The slight irregularities are not flaws but signatures of authenticity, giving each piece a unique charm.

Block Printing in Modern Fashion
Today, block prints have beautifully adapted to contemporary styles. From shirts and kurtas to bedsheets, bathrobes, and cushions, artisans continue to blend traditional techniques with modern designs.
